SubjectRe: [BUG?] INFO: rcu_sched detected expedited stalls on CPUs/tasks: { 0-.... } 3 jiffies s: 309 root: 0x1/.
Hi, Paul,

On Thu, 13 Apr 2023 at 15:43, Paul E. McKenney <paulmck@kernel.org> wrote:
>
> My guess would be that you have CONFIG_RCU_EXP_CPU_STALL_TIMEOUT set to
> some small non-zero number, for example, you might have set up a recent
> Android .config or some such. The default of zero would give you about
> 21 seconds rather than the three jiffies that you are seeing.
>
> Could you please check your .config?

Well, this is embarrassing. I can't fathom why/how, but I had it set
to 20, on this machine. That is, 20 millisseconds. I guess its a
miracle I haven't seen *more* expedited RCU traces. Sorry for the
noise, everyone.
